My understanding is that a leading "'" can be used to keep leading zeros. 

Hence inputing '071 in a cell should display 071,
and   inputing '71 in a cell should display 71 etc.

But in some situations (sorry very little idea why, but see below)
      inputing '071 in a cell displays 071071, and even 071071071

Further experimentation suggests that it is a function of cell width, why this
should be so I have no idea.
